E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
主从库读写分离
架构第2章 高性能数据库集群
本文参考《极客时间》-从0开始学架构高性能数据库集群第一种方式是“
读写分离
”,其本质是将访问压力分散到集群中的多个节点,但是没有分散存储压力;第二种方式是“分库分表”,既可以分散访问压力,又可以分散存储压力
小螺丝钉cici
·
2023-04-01 04:15
18、MySQL分库分表,原理实战
MySQL分库分表,原理实战1.MyCAT分布式架构入门及双主架构1.1主从架构1.2MyCAT安装1.3启动和连接1.4配置文件介绍2.MyCAT
读写分离
架构2.1架构说明2.2创建用户2.3schema.xml2.4
数哥
·
2023-03-31 23:53
mysql
数据库
linux
DDD的简单落地及防腐层(ACL)
-->目前市面主流面向业务模型:以领域模型替代替数据库表模型(DDD+SOA微服务:事件驱动的CQRS
读写分离
架构)DDD内核领域驱动设计是一种由领域模型来驱动系统设计的思想,不是通过数据库表来驱动系统设计
暴躁屠龙骑士
·
2023-03-31 22:56
领域驱动设计(DDD)
系统架构
美团二面:为什么 Redis 会有哨兵?
在Redis的主从架构中,由于主从模式是
读写分离
的,如果主节点(master)挂了,那么将没有主节点来服务客户端的写操作请求,也没有主节点给从节点(slave)进行数据同步了。
java领域
·
2023-03-31 18:03
redis
数据库
网络
经验分享
面试
C++实现线程安全的的双缓冲实例
redis设计方案由于业务非常适合map的结构,因此采用了双层maptypedefstd::mapEventCountMap;typedefstd::mapRuleEventCountMap;为了实现
读写分离
mooncreek
·
2023-03-31 17:09
Linux服务器开发
c++
java
开发语言
MySQL笔记——安装MySQL Router 8
可以用来解决MySQL
主从库
读写分离
的路由或MySQL集群的高可用、负载均衡、易扩展等方面。而且对于应用来说是透明的。 本次介绍的是在MySQL主从架构(一主一从)上的应用,主要用于
读写分离
。
Major_ZYH
·
2023-03-31 16:02
MySQL
mysql
数据库
C++实现
读写分离
的双缓冲buffer
目录1、双缓冲区
读写分离
2、后台线程定时更新数据3、类设计完整代码cache.cppcache.hmain.cppmakefile
读写分离
的双缓冲buffer有以下好处:提高了并发读写的效率:在多线程环境下
拾牙慧者
·
2023-03-31 16:22
#
并发/行
多线/进程
IPC
#
C++linux后台开发入门
#
C++
挖坑与填坑
c++
linux
双缓冲buffer
读书笔记《大型网站技术架构核心原理与案例》-李智慧
花时间读了前阿里巴巴人称教授的李智慧老师的《大型网站技术架构和心原理与案例》一书,将笔记记录在此,有需要原作的可私信一.发展1.应用服务器和数据服务器分离2.使用缓存3.应用服务器集群改善并发4.数据
读写分离
charlie_wang007
·
2023-03-31 12:21
网络架构
分布式
数据库
队列
架构设计
目录第一次演进:Tomcat与数据库分开部署第二次演进:引入本地缓存和分布式缓存第三次演进:引入反向代理实现负载均衡第四次演进:数据库
读写分离
第五次演进:数据库按业务分库第六次演进:把大表拆分为小表第七次演进
程序三两行
·
2023-03-31 11:24
#
开发vlog
DM集群架构及原理
DM集群类型二、DM归档类型三、数据守护集群3.1数据守护集群概念3.2数据守护集群架构及原理3.3守护进程主要功能3.4守护进程故障切换模式以及进程状态3.5监视器作用及类型3.6数据守护的优点四、
读写分离
集群
木子风1
·
2023-03-31 09:48
达梦数据库
数据库
database
微服务架构从0到1,搭建全过程记录,手把手教学,连载中...
Linux主机centos7.9虚拟机安装,设置磁盘挂载架构设计微服务高性能高可用架构设计安装KeepalivedNginx基础使用、配置文件详解、Keepalived高可用mysql集群,主从同步,
读写分离
mildness丶
·
2023-03-31 07:44
JAVA
微服务
OPPO云数据库访问服务技术解析
不合理的数据库访问,比如不恰当的连接池设置、高危SQL无拦截、无限流和熔断等治理能力无弹性伸缩能力,单机数据库性能或者容量不足时,扩容非常繁琐低效缺乏常用的功能特性,不支持
读写分离
、影子库表、单元
OPPO互联网技术官方账号
·
2023-03-31 05:34
后端
运维
计算机软件架构发展史
计算机软件架构发展历史(一)软件架构初识概述基本概念软件架构演进过程单体架构初步设计Web服务与数据库分开本地缓存和分布式缓存反向代理与负载均衡设计数据库
读写分离
设计数据库按业务进行分库大表拆分为小表LVS
程序员&&&&&攻城狮
·
2023-03-31 00:53
java
1210、MHA集群
文章目录总结之前数据存储架构的优缺点:1、主从结构存储数据2、数据
读写分离
3、分库分表MHA集群一、概述1、MHA软件介绍2、MHA集群架构3、MHA集群的工作过程4、拓扑结构二、部署MHA集群配置MHA
朱帅杰1
·
2023-03-30 22:52
12
RDBMS关系型数据库管理系统
服务器
数据库
运维
mysql理解(二)_缓存
binglog,通过io-thread写入(write)从库本地relaylog(中继日志);3.从库通过sql-thread读取(read)relaylog,并把更新事件在从库中执行(replay)一遍例如微博
读写分离
架构如下图为什么需要缓冲层
lyt_dawang
·
2023-03-30 20:11
网络编程
一文把Redis主从复制、哨兵、Cluster三种模式摸透
可能,在一般公司的程序员使用单机版基本都能解决问题,在Redis的官网给出的数据是10WQPS,这对于应付一般的公司绰绰有余了,再不行就来个主从模式,实现
读写分离
,性能又大大提高。但是,我们作为有
ITMuch.com
·
2023-03-30 20:38
数据库
分布式
redis
linux
java
redis:从入门到入土:10.Redis哨兵机制
.哨兵的作用和原理1.集群结构和作用2.集群监控原理3.集群故障恢复原理4.小结二.搭建哨兵集群1.准备实例和配置2.启动3.测试三.整合springboot1.引入依赖2.配置Redis地址3.配置
读写分离
四
alonePointer
·
2023-03-30 20:25
redis
redis
数据库
java
mysql 数据库集群搭建:(四)pacemaker管理三台maxscale集群,搭建mariadb
读写分离
中间层集群...
为什么80%的码农都做不了架构师?>>>《mysql数据库集群搭建:(一)VirtualBox中多台CentOS虚拟机间和windows主机间互通以及访问互联网设置》《mysql数据库集群搭建:(二)3台CentOS-7安装Percona-XtraDB-Cluster-57集群》《mysql数据库集群搭建:(三)CentOS7.2MariaDB10.2galera集群安装》《mysql数据库集群搭
weixin_34026484
·
2023-03-30 19:16
数据库
用真实业务场景告诉你,高并发下如何设计数据库架构?
目录:用一个创业公司的发展作为背景引入用多台服务器来分库支撑高并发读写大量分表来保证海量数据下查询性能
读写分离
来支撑按需扩容及性能提升高并发下的数据库架构设计总结这篇文章,我们来聊一下对于一个支撑日活百万用户的高并系统
石杉的架构笔记
·
2023-03-30 15:55
职场
数据库
Java
数据库架构
架构
java
面试官问我有没有高并发架构经验,我慌的一批…
目录一、1道面试题的背景引入二、先考虑一个最简单的系统架构三、系统集群化部署四、数据库分库分表+
读写分离
五、缓存集群引入六、引入消息中间件集群七、现在能hold住高并发面试题了吗八、本文能带给你什么启发
石杉的架构笔记
·
2023-03-30 15:24
面试求职
架构
Java
架构
java
数据库
互联网架构演进之路
目录1单体架构2分布式架构2.1应用集群2.2分布式缓存2.3业务拆分2.4分库分表和
读写分离
2.5静态化和CDN2.6异步解耦3微服务架构3.1为什么需要服务化3.2服务化的好处3.3服务化的问题1单体架构公司发展的初期
赵广陆
·
2023-03-30 10:00
architect
架构
服务器
数据库
一周技术学习笔记(第62期)-CQRS是”有点不同“的
读写分离
为了提升对数据库的性能,我们又做了
读写分离
。上面这个图是我们最为熟悉的
读写分离
场景了,另外我们也熟悉了这样的方法有两个不好地方。1、写库有单点故障问题。2、数据库同步有延迟。
新栋BOOK
·
2023-03-30 10:48
数据库
java
分布式
python
大数据
09-redis cluster扩容
rediscluster模式下,不建议做物理的
读写分离
了 我们建议通过master的水平扩容,来横向扩展读写吞吐量,还有支撑更多的海量数据 redis单机,读吞吐是5w/s,写吞吐2w/s 扩展
逍遥俊子
·
2023-03-30 09:50
Redis集群
MySQL之搭建主从架构及主从带来的问题
让主库极其接近从库,主库宕机,启动从库开展业务2、实现
读写分离
,在从库设置只读参数3、备份,避免影响业务二、原理1、从库启动一个线程(叫做IO线程),连接主库2、主库接受连接,主库为从库启动一个线程(dump
我说,你好
·
2023-03-30 05:07
MySQL体系结构
面试笔记二(总结的答案可能有误,感谢批评指正)
笔者把这个问题改为:如何实现MySQL的
读写分离
?MySQL主从复制原理是啥?如果写入数据量过大,主从延迟较大,怎么办?如果
读写分离
,写后立刻读,发现读不到数据,怎么办?
Miriwas
·
2023-03-30 03:44
面试总结
面试
数据库
mysql
golang
数据结构
《架构300讲》学习笔记(1-50)
读写分离
将一个数据库拆分为读库和写库,
读写分离
集群模式:在原有的基础上增加中间层,与后端数据集构成
读写分离
的集群。
newProxyInstance
·
2023-03-30 03:06
笔记
架构
架构学习笔记1
架构设计三原则4,架构复杂度的六个来源1,高性能2,高可用3,可扩展性4,低成本5,安全6,规模5,架构设计流程1,识别复杂度2,设计备选方案3,评估和选择备选方案4,详细方案设计6,常用的高性能架构模式1,
读写分离
架构
码农充电站
·
2023-03-30 02:23
技术入门
mysql
数据库
database
架构
系统架构
浅谈一下如何保证Redis缓存与数据库的一致性
目录1、四种同步策略:2、更新缓存还是删除缓存2.1更新缓存2.2删除缓存3、先操作数据库还是缓存3.1先删除缓存再更新数据库3.2先更新数据库再删除缓存最终结论:4、延时双删4.1采用
读写分离
的架构怎么办
·
2023-03-30 02:20
主从
读写分离
学习记录
读写分离
,基本思想是让主数据库处理增,删,改,的操作(INSERT、DELETE、UPDATE)而从数据库处理SELECT查询操作。在高并发的业务场景中,除了实现分布式负载均衡之外。
是苑昭阳阿
·
2023-03-30 01:48
django实现mysql主从配置
而redis的
读写分离
可参考:redis
sandwu
·
2023-03-30 01:28
mysql
主从配置
mysql
django
python
Mysql主从搭建与Django实现
读写分离
文章目录Mysql主从搭建与Django实现
读写分离
主从同步原理主从同步实现Django实现
读写分离
进阶Mysql主从搭建与Django实现
读写分离
主从同步原理master会将变动记录写道二进制日志里面
go&Python
·
2023-03-30 00:08
#
Django框架
mysql
django
数据库
mysql主从复制和
读写分离
实验部署
mysql主从复制和
读写分离
实验部署实验思路1、客户端访问代理服务器2、代理服务器写入到主服务器3、主服务器将增删改写入自己二进制日志4、从服务器将主服务器的二进制日志同步至自己中继日志5、从服务器重放中继日志到数据库中
修勾不修勾
·
2023-03-30 00:07
mysql
服务器
linux
mysql常用的优化
读写分离
:当一台服务器不能满足需求时,采用
读写分离
的方式进行集群。缓存:使用redis来进行缓存语句优化:比如少使用子查询而用join操作,少使用or多用IN
修勾不修勾
·
2023-03-30 00:07
mysql
数据库
redis
配置Django实现数据库
读写分离
**django在进行数据库操作的时候,读取数据与写数据(增、删、改)可以分别从不同的数据库进行操作。**在配置文件中增加slave数据库的配置DATABASES={‘default’:{‘ENGINE’:‘django.db.backends.mysql’,‘HOST’:‘10.211.55.5’,‘PORT’:3306,‘USER’:‘meiduo’,‘PASSWORD’:‘meiduo’,‘
知阅码
·
2023-03-30 00:32
Django部署
数据库读写分离
配置
Django主从数据库分离配置
数据库主从配置,django发表时间:2020-08-25对网站的数据库作
读写分离
(Read/WriteSplitting)可以提高性能,在Django中对此提供了支持,下面我们来简单看一下。
月疯
·
2023-03-30 00:30
【Django】
MySQL主从配置(Django实现主从配置
读写分离
)
目录一MySQL主从配置原理(主从分离,主从同步)三:django实现主从
读写分离
(主从同步)一MySQL主从配置原理(主从分离,主从同步)mysql主从配置的流程大体如图:1)master会将变动记录到二进制日志里面
ikt4435
·
2023-03-30 00:26
Java
编程
程序员
mysql
django
docker
Django框架使用mysql主从数据库实现
读写分离
1前提是你已经配置好你的mysql主从,参见上篇2.在配置文件中增加slave数据库的配置DATABASES={'default':{'ENGINE':'django.db.backends.mysql','HOST':'127.0.0.1','PORT':3306,#主'USER':'root',#主数据库用户名'PASSWORD':'password',#主数据库密码'NAME':'datab
onceYoung
·
2023-03-30 00:55
mysql
Django
看这里!Redis-RESP协议与AOF持久化有什么关系?面试突击版!
Git的相关理论基础日常开发中,Git的基本常用命令Git进阶之分支处理Git进阶之处理冲突Git进阶之撤销与回退Git进阶之标签tagGit其他一些经典命令高并发架构消息队列搜索引擎缓存分库分表
读写分离
设计高并发系统高并发架构部分内容缓存
最新Java开发面试
·
2023-03-29 23:49
程序员
java
后端
面试
阿里数据库中间件TDDL原理
1)单一数据库无法满足性能需求随着业务的发展,数据量急剧增大,使用单库单表时,数据库压力过大,因此通过分库分表,
读写分离
的方式,减轻数据库的压力。
任嘉平生愿
·
2023-03-29 21:23
redis集群环境搭建
CentOS7),实现三主三从集群环境的搭建一、集群环境介绍redis高可用方案有四种,分别为:(1)数据持久化RDB和AOF,redis4.0之后,引入RDB+AOF混合持久化(2)主从复制,即数据
读写分离
Master_清风
·
2023-03-29 21:17
redis
linux
springboot
redis
springboot
linux
Redis高级篇(一)分布式缓存
一、单点redis问题:1、数据丢失问题实现redis数据持久化2、并发问题搭建主从集群,实现
读写分离
3、故障恢复问题搭建redis哨兵,实现监控监测和自动恢复4、存储能力问题搭建分片集群,利用插槽机制实现动态扩容二
珠光
·
2023-03-29 18:58
Redis
redis
缓存
数据库
【redis】7.1 分布式架构概述(章节介绍)
1.本章节内容分布式缓存中间件Redis分布式会话与单点登录分布式搜索引擎Elasticsearch分布式文件系统分布式消息队列分布式锁数据库
读写分离
与分库分表数据库表全局唯一主键id设计分布式事务与数据一致性接口幂等设计与分布式限流
ladymorgana
·
2023-03-29 17:48
架构师之路-java
redis
分布式
架构
SpringCloud Alibaba系列——13Dubbo的服务治理和监听机制(下)
我们以
读写分离
路由为例去配置,关于动态路由配置规则,请参照dubbo官网的路由配置规则:路由规则|ApacheDubbomethod=find*,list*,get
Eclipse_2019
·
2023-03-29 17:31
SpringCloud
alibaba系列
spring
cloud
dubbo
java
java-zookeeper
分布式
Dockercompose创建redis主从复制
主从复制概念主从复制,是指将一台redis服务器的数据,复制到其他的redis服务器.前者称为主节点,后者称为从节点.数据的复制是单向的,只能由主节点复制到从节点.Master以写为主,Slave以读为主.主从复制,
读写分离
别过来,你胖到我了_
·
2023-03-29 17:00
笔记
redis
docker
Redis系列之-主从复制原理与优化
一什么是主从复制机器故障;容量瓶颈;QPS瓶颈一主一从,一主多从做
读写分离
做数据副本扩展数据性能一个maskter可以有多个slave一个slave只能有一个master数据流向是单向的,从master
just_do_it_98
·
2023-03-29 16:12
数据库
redis高级
redis
数据库
Spring Boot 中 Redis 的使用
除此之外,Redis还提供一些类数据库的特性,比如事务,HA,
主从库
。可以说Redis兼具了缓存系统和数据库的一些特性,因此有着丰富的应用场景
IT职业与自媒体思考
·
2023-03-29 16:32
「绝密档案」“爆料”完整秒杀架构的设计到技术关键点的“八卦追踪”
本章内容在此会进行扩展技术介绍,以下内容:架构思考三高特性的介绍CAP一致性理论热点分离热点识别技术热点隔离技术热点优化技术数据高可用
读写分离
分库分表数据合并数据库调优DB层面的单行记录做并发排队机制架构思考从整体思考问题
洛神灬殇
·
2023-03-29 16:34
编程心法思维基本功底系列
架构
java
数据库
MySQL主从复制的概念和原理(秒懂)
实现
读写分离
,降低主库的访问压力。。可以在从库中执行备份
一腔热血1007
·
2023-03-29 15:26
数据库
mysql
sql
mysql 高可用架构汇总(一)
本方案是简单的主从方案•本方案是有一个Master复制到一个或者多个Slave的架构模式,通过Master对数据库进行写操作,通过Slave端进行读操作,该方案主要用在读写压力比较大的应用系统中,可以达到
读写分离
以及负载均衡
博浪依秋
·
2023-03-29 15:08
mysql
MySQL高可用架构
binlog_ignore_db=ignoreDB(多个)在从库配置(默认全部db):replicate-do-db=dbNamereplicate-rewrite-db=masterDbname->slaveDbname,
主从库
名
wangjianren0000
·
2023-03-29 14:14
MySQL
高可用
数据库架构
上一页
33
34
35
36
37
38
39
40
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他